Well.............first note that this was a thread I started last year. I don't really have things organized yet for this year. But what I have always done is do the actual trading in the spring, as weather after digging can be really chancy for shipping tubers safely.

On another site that I frequent, everyone posts a list of the tubers that they expect to have available for trading (after they dig and see what they have), then participants contact each other (tree-mail here would be best) with wish lists. Ideally everyone's tubers last through the storage season, but if not then adjustments are made in the spring.

Last year, I turned my ATP plant list into my list of available tubers (I had a lot and was selling as well as trading) It worked well because pics and info became part of the list, and its easy to edit as the number of available tubers decreases. I then posted this thread here and posted a thread in the ATP classifieds which reaches more people than just the few of us that frequent the dahlia forum. However, what might work better for us as a group is to start a new thread here "Available for trade spring 2016", and everyone could post their lists there, and/or if they want to use the ATP plant lists, post a link to their page.

I prefer to ship using priority mail. The small boxes ship for about $6, and can hold 6-10 tubers depending on the size of the tubers, the medium boxes are 12.65 (?) and can hold up to 25 or so. If its only 1-2 tubers then you can sometimes get away with using padded envelopes, but some tubers are just to fat for those. Last year I put 1-3 tubers in ziplocks with vermiculite, labeled both the tubers themselves and the baggies, and everything arrived safely.
